Sydney balcony fall: Woman dies after falling 10 storeys off Hyatt Regency Hotel
A woman fell 10 storeys to her death from a Sydney hotel last night, with her boyfriend questioned by police before being released.
A woman has died after falling 10 storeys off the balcony of a Sydney hotel last night.
Police arrested a man known to the victim, who is believed to be the woman’s boyfriend, but he has since been released.
It’s not the only balcony death that occurred last night. In a completely separate incident, a teenage boy fell off a balcony in the Gold Coast and tragically died.

Just after 8pm last night, emergency services were called to the Hyatt Regency Hotel in Darling Harbour, following reports a woman had fallen from her 10th-storey room.
Officers and NSW Ambulance paramedics found the woman’s body on the level one rooftop of the hotel.
The woman is yet to be formally identified, however, is believed to be aged 45.
A crime scene has been established which continues to be forensically examined.
A 48-year-old man – known to the woman, and believed to be her partner – was arrested at the scene and taken to Day Street Police Station.
He has since been released pending further investigation.
Police said it’s too early to determine whether the woman’s death is suspicious.
Police also confirmed the hotel is not a coronavirus isolation point for returning travellers.
Detectives have established Strike Force Cumulus to investigate the circumstances surrounding the woman’s death and are appealing for anyone with information or who was in the area at the time to come forward.
Inquiries are continuing.
